The upper panel displays an oil painting of a coastal harbour view with sailing vessels, figures on the shoreline and classical architectural elements in the background, beautifully capturing the romantic spirit of traditional maritime art.

The painting is enclosed within an ornate Rococo-style gilt surround with scrolling foliate decoration, which sits above the rectangular mirror plate. The mirror itself is framed by further carved and gilded detailing, all mounted on the original painted wooden backing board with a moulded cornice to the top.

Trumeau mirrors such as this were traditionally placed above fireplaces or between windows in French interiors, where they provided both decorative interest and reflected light around a room. The combination of painted panel and mirror makes these pieces particularly attractive and highly sought after for both period and contemporary interiors.
